Greg Kachadurian
gregthestig
Ferrari FXX leads 599xx
Taken at the 2016 Ferrari Finali Mondiali at Daytona International Speedway.
649
views
1
fave
0
comments
Uploaded on December 8, 2016
Taken on December 3, 2016
Ferrari FXX leads 599xx
Taken at the 2016 Ferrari Finali Mondiali at Daytona International Speedway.
649
views
1
fave
0
comments
Uploaded on December 8, 2016
Taken on December 3, 2016